+#if 0
+/*
+ * Compute the PrPMC750's bus speed using the baud clock as a
+ * reference.
+ */
+unsigned long __init powerpmc250_get_bus_speed(void)
+{
+ unsigned long tbl_start, tbl_end;
+ unsigned long current_state, old_state, bus_speed;
+ unsigned char lcr, dll, dlm;
+ int baud_divisor, count;
+
+ /* Read the UART's baud clock divisor */
+ lcr = readb(PRPMC750_SERIAL_0_LCR);
+ writeb(lcr | UART_LCR_DLAB, PRPMC750_SERIAL_0_LCR);
+ dll = readb(PRPMC750_SERIAL_0_DLL);
+ dlm = readb(PRPMC750_SERIAL_0_DLM);
+ writeb(lcr & ~UART_LCR_DLAB, PRPMC750_SERIAL_0_LCR);
+ baud_divisor = (dlm << 8) | dll;
+
+ /*
+ * Use the baud clock divisor and base baud clock
+ * to determine the baud rate and use that as
+ * the number of baud clock edges we use for
+ * the time base sample. Make it half the baud
+ * rate.
+ */
+ count = PRPMC750_BASE_BAUD / (baud_divisor * 16);
+
+ /* Find the first edge of the baud clock */
+ old_state = readb(PRPMC750_STATUS_REG) & PRPMC750_BAUDOUT_MASK;
+ do {
+ current_state = readb(PRPMC750_STATUS_REG) &
+ PRPMC750_BAUDOUT_MASK;
+ } while(old_state == current_state);
+
+ old_state = current_state;
+
+ /* Get the starting time base value */
+ tbl_start = get_tbl();
+
+ /*
+ * Loop until we have found a number of edges equal
+ * to half the count (half the baud rate)
+ */
+ do {
+ do {
+ current_state = readb(PRPMC750_STATUS_REG) &
+ PRPMC750_BAUDOUT_MASK;
+ } while(old_state == current_state);
+ old_state = current_state;
+ } while (--count);
+
+ /* Get the ending time base value */
+ tbl_end = get_tbl();
+
+ /* Compute bus speed */
+ bus_speed = (tbl_end-tbl_start)*128;
+
+ return bus_speed;
+}
+#endif

+static int
+powerpmc250_exclude_device(u_char bus, u_char devfn)
+{
+ /*
+ * While doing PCI Scan the MPC107 will 'detect' itself as
+ * device on the PCI Bus, will create an incorrect response and
+ * later will respond incorrectly to Configuration read coming
+ * from another device.
+ *
+ * The work around is that when doing a PCI Scan one
+ * should skip its own device number in the scan.
+ *
+ * The top IDsel is AD13 and the middle is AD14.
+ *
+ * -- Note from force
+ */
+
+ if ((bus == 0) && (PCI_SLOT(devfn) == 13 || PCI_SLOT(devfn) == 14)) {
+ return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
+ }
+ else {
+ return PCIBIOS_SUCCESSFUL;
+ }
+}
